What is the difference between Remote Micro Systems Engineering vs Remote Embedded Systems Engineering?

AspectRemote Micro Systems EngineeringRemote Embedded Systems Engineering
Required CredentialsBachelor's or higher in Micro Systems, Electrical, or Computer Engineering; certifications like IPC or IEEE are commonBachelor's or higher in Electrical, Computer, or Embedded Systems Engineering; similar certifications
Work EnvironmentDesign, develop, and test micro-scale systems remotely, often involving CAD tools and simulation softwareDevelop and integrate embedded software/hardware for devices, often involving firmware and real-time systems
Employer & Industry UsageTech companies, manufacturing, aerospace, and research institutionsConsumer electronics, automotive, medical devices, and industrial automation

Remote Micro Systems Engineering and Remote Embedded Systems Engineering share similar educational backgrounds and work environments. However, Micro Systems Engineering focuses on designing micro-scale hardware, while Embedded Systems Engineering emphasizes software development for embedded devices. Both roles are vital in tech industries and often overlap in skills and tools used.

Job Description- MBSE (Model-Based Systems Engineering) Systems EngineerLocation- RemoteJob Summary

We are seeking an MBSE Systems Engineer to support the development, analysis, and management of complex systems using Model-Based Systems Engineering (MBSE) methodologies. The ideal candidate will work with cross-functional teams to define system requirements, develop system architectures, and create system models that improve traceability, consistency, and lifecycle management.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and maintain system models using MBSE methodologies and tools.
  • Capture, analyze, and manage system requirements.
  • Create system architecture, behavior, structure, and interface models.
  • Support system design, verification, validation, and integration activities.
  • Ensure traceability between requirements, design artifacts, and test cases.
  • Collaborate with engineering, software, hardware, and project teams throughout the system lifecycle.
  • Perform impact analysis and support change management activities.
  • Generate engineering documentation and reports from system models.
  • Participate in technical reviews, design reviews, and stakeholder meetings.
  • Support process improvement initiatives related to systems engineering and MBSE adoption.
Required Skills & Experience
  • Experience with Model-Based Systems Engineering (MBSE) principles and practices.
  • Knowledge of systems engineering lifecycle processes.
  • Hands-on experience with MBSE tools such as:
    • Cameo Systems Modeler / MagicDraw
    • IBM Rational Rhapsody
    • Sparx Enterprise Architect
    • Capella (preferred)
  • Experience with SysML/UML modeling.
  • Understanding of requirements management and traceability.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work in a multidisciplinary engineering environment.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Systems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, Computer Engineering, or a related field.
  • Knowledge of systems engineering standards such as:
    • INCOSE MBSE
    • ISO/IEC/IEEE 15288
    • DoDAF, UAF, or NAF frameworks
  • Experience in Aerospace, Defense, Automotive, Manufacturing, Energy, or Industrial Systems domains.
  • Familiarity with requirements management tools such as:
    • IBM DOORS
    • Jama
    • Polarion
